Top Hybridcasual Games Performance in Slovenia Q4 2025
Explore the performance trends of the top hybridcasual games in Slovenia during Q4 2025, including revenue, downloads, and active users.
In the fourth quarter of 2025, Slovenia's hybridcasual gaming scene saw intriguing trends across various metrics. The data, sourced from Sensor Tower, highlights the performance of the top five games on a unified platform.
Screwdom, published by Zego Global Pte Ltd, showed a fluctuating revenue pattern, peaking at around $1.3K in mid-November. Weekly downloads experienced a high of approximately 399 in the first week of November, while active users increased from 4K to 4.4K by the end of December.
Archero 2 from HABBY displayed a varied revenue stream, hitting a low of $119 in late November but rebounding to $952 by late December. Downloads remained relatively stable, with a slight increase to 43 in the final week. Active users fluctuated, ending the quarter at 335.
Color Block Jam by Rollic Games saw a revenue spike of $857 in late October. Despite a decline in downloads from 705 to a steady 239-241 range, active users remained just above 3K throughout the quarter.
Match Factory!, published by Peak Games, experienced a revenue dip mid-quarter but recovered to $602 by December 22. Downloads showed a significant increase to 519 in the last week, while active users rose from 1.3K to 1.8K by the quarter's end.
Lastly, Rush Royale: Tower Defense RPG from MYGAMES MENA FZ LLC had a notable revenue surge to $825 mid-December. Although downloads decreased significantly, active users remained fairly consistent, hovering around 600-700.
